Would be great to have a category for system apps like trophies, vita settings etc. That way one can have the launcher run at startup and not have to go back to the Vita UI for anything.

System apps have a special property where you can open them while you have another app open but HexLauncher Custom itself doesn't have this property. I added system apps in SwitchView (enable view 5 via the start menu) thinking that I would use it a lot but I honestly, much more often I find myself just going to the actual Vita LiveArea and opening them there so I don't have to close my game. Many of the system apps are included in SwitchView but trophies are not. I have no idea how to do it but I was thinking possibly maybe one day to have it where you can view a game's manual via the triangle menu (functionality should be: 1: go in triangle menu, 2: click "view game manual" 3: it will open the app and open it's manual but still keep the HexLauncher Custom app running). This gives me the idea to do something similar where you can click "view this game's trophies" via triangle menu. Then you could hit circle to view all trophies. I'll add this all to my to-do list now.

"System apps have a special property where you can open them while you have another app open but HexLauncher Custom itself doesn't have this property." I had wondered about this some and it is problematic. Having to close Hexflow would somewhat defeat the purpose, but wouldn't it leave the launcher window open? So when you are done in the system app you just go back over to the HexFlow launcher tab and relaunch without going back through the live area bubbles? I have well over 100 bubbles and after the live area processes so many the icons stop working, I'd like to basically make the live area unnecessary. As of now (currently using Retroflow) I only need it for the settings and trophies apps.

Being able to lock apps to home screen tabs would work but that wouldn't be a HexFlow/RetroFlow thing.
